This is an independent, structured reference to the CMS Rural Health Transformation Program (RHTP) — a $50 billion, five-year program covering all 50 states ($10.0B in Year-1 awards tracked here). It exists to collect, in one predictable place per state, facts that are otherwise scattered across federal and state government sites. It is not a government site, and it is not the program’s commentary layer — interpretation, opinion and reporting live on the separate Rural Health Transformation Grant Tracker newsletter.
Award amounts, administering agencies, procurement details and dates are drawn from the primary sources above and from the program’s own dated reporting. Where a precise figure (e.g. an exact CMS award) appears in a primary source, we use it; otherwise we label a figure as approximate. We do not invent figures, agencies, or dates.
A state is profiled once it has a CMS RHTP award. An activity-log entry is included when the program’s reporting covers that state by name. Spotted an error or omission? Corrections are welcome — the fastest path is the newsletter contact channel; verified corrections are applied at the next regeneration.
We keep a strict line between facts (award amounts, agencies, official documents, procurements, dates — here) and analysis (interpretation, trends, implications — on the newsletter). Profiles link into the newsletter’s dated briefs for context, but the reference layer stays neutral.
